Urban Takes the A-Train


Urban has received four task orders from the Denton County Transportation Authority (DCTA)  for design services in connection with the development of the A-Train; a planned 21-mile commuter rail line in Denton County, Texas.  The A-Train will parallel Interstate 35E and serve as an extension with the Dallas Area Rapid Transit Green Line at Trinity Mills Station in Carrollton.

DCTA recently finalized a contract with On-Track 2010, a Joint Venture of Urban Engineers, Lockwood Andrews & Newman, Inc., and Bowman Engineering to provide professional support services during final design and construction of the rail project.  These services will supplement agency personnel and will provide a variety of services in conjunction with the A-Train and DCTA’s bus operations.

Under the new task orders, Urban will provide support services for the design of a rail vehicle maintenance facility; help develop a System Safety Program Plan, a System Safety Certification Plan, and a Project Management Plan; provide vehicle procurement engineering assistance; and provide support services relating to the development, facilitation, and implementation of a fare collection system.
